MF61 JJE is a 2011 Lexus IS220 in Blue with a 2,231c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.

Across all 2011 Lexus IS220 models, the average MOT pass rate is 82.8% with a typical mileage of 82,299 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Lexus IS220 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 5,421 recorded failures. If you're considering buying MF61 JJE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Lexus IS220 typically stays on UK roads for around 20 years. At 15 years old, this Lexus IS220 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
